What became clear is this: technology doesn’t fix inequality on its own. If we don’t question the systems, assumptions, and power structures behind it, AI will simply reflect the world as it is , and amplify it.

The discussion brought together voices from policy, education, civil society, industry, and community practice to explore what it really takes to make AI work for everyone, not just in principle, but in everyday life.
